Course Overview

Mention the name Robert Frost and anyone familiar with poetry remembers reading “Stopping by the Woods on a Snowy Evening” in high school. Behind those lines is a man who was plagued by tragedy most of this life. His father died when Frost was eleven, leaving the family destitute. His mother and sister as well - as Frost himself - suffered from mental illness which followed his family into the next generation. He never finished college and failed as a farmer. Yet, his poetry became an iconic representation of American rural life for which he won four Pulitzer Prizes.

Who was this man whose epitaph reads “I had a lover’s quarrel with the world”?
